DTC Troubleshooting: B1001, B1002

DTC B1001: MICU Internal (CPU) Error

DTC B1002: MICU Internal (EEPROM) Error

NOTE: If you are troubleshooting multiple DTCs, be sure to follow the instructions in B-CAN System Diagnosis Test Mode A. Troubleshooting - B-CAN System Diagnosis Test Mode A

1. Clear the DTCs with the HDS.

2. Turn the ignition switch to LOCK (0) and then back to ON (II).

3. Wait for at least 6 seconds.

4. Check for DTCs with the HDS.

Is DTC B1001 and/or B1002 indicated?
YES - Faulty MICU, replace the driver's under-dash fuse/relay box.

NO - Intermittent failure, the system is OK at this time.
